Who funds Progressive Health Partnership Inc Nfp

EIN 27-2624947 · Homewood, IL · NTEE Q33

Progressive Health Partnership Inc Nfp of Homewood, IL (EIN 27-2624947) was named as a grant recipient by 1 funder in 5 grants paid totaling $425,000 in tax years 2018–2023,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
